Adding a Measurement Type to an Existing Program

Adding a Measurement Type to an Existing Program

This article pertains to: Impact

Impact allows you to add a new measurement type to a program after the program is live. For example, if you have a blood pressure program that is live (with the blood pressure measurement type), you can add weight to that program. This new measurement type will only be available to program participants enrolled after the measurement type has been added.

 

Recommended Implementation Steps:

  1. Work with your Validic implementation contact to add a new data source to Impact for the new measurement type: Adding a New Data Source to Impact

  2. Update Admin > Content with needed program content changes with the new measurement type

  3. Enable the measurement type in Admin > Program Overview

  4. Add program Goals and Events/Actions (Notifications) for the new measurement type in Admin > Goals and Admin > Events/Actions (Notifications)

  5. New enrollments will now have the ability to connect a source for the new measurement type.
